Quick report
Gulf of Slides was thoroughly in spring snowpack with a snow surface that softened well from the previous nights refreeze. Very small isolated pockets of snow (1-4” deep) from the minimal 4/18-19 snow could be found lower in the gullies filling in depressions but not much for new snow higher up. Main, Gully 2, and Gully 3 were still in good shape but the GOS ski trail is only skiable partway down.
